(Some clips in this episode have minor spoilers). Oh I love a tone like this: funny, smart but also emotional, dark and dramatic: let's call it an American neurotic-cozy murder mystery. There is a mystery at the heart of this show, and an amazing house, but it's also about a lovely peaceful neighborhood full of interesting couples grappling with some real issues and a desperate desire to own this historic space, complete with mandarin tree, in the Los Feliz neighborhood of L.A. Who does this house really belong to? Who deserves it more? Who has the resources to top the others for it? And should they? Despite some mildly violent cutthroat moments, the story has a heartwarming, happy ending.
